TD Canadian Children’s Book Week this week

TD Canadian Children’s Book Week this week

This week marks TD Canadian Children's Book Week, and a renowned children’s author will be touring Saskatchewan including North Battleford. Cary Fagan will be touring the region until Friday, May 8.

Pat Gotto: ‘I’ve always been busy’

Pat Gotto: ‘I’ve always been busy’

“I’ve always been busy, all my life, because I was a working mom and it becomes habit that you stay busy.” That’s how Pat Gotto explains her curriculum vitae as a thrice-retired registered nurse and inveterate volunteer.
